After the films 'Pathan' and 'Veda', actors John Abraham will soon be seen again on silverscreen. The teaser of John Abraham's upcoming film 'The Diplomate' has been released. The teaser of about a minute begins with a clip by External Affairs Minister S Jaishankar, in which he says that the greatest diplomat in the world was Sri Krishna and a Hanumanji. This is followed by John Abraham's entry on the screen. The film stars John in the lead role, playing the role of JP Singh.
In this teaser, a woman is seen wearing a burqa and describing herself as an Indian citizen. Then the next moment John Abraham is seen questioning him. John asks him to tell the truth. After this it was revealed that the people of ISI are behind John. On this, he says, “This is Pakistan, son, man or horse, does not walk straight, always has two and a half steps.”
Directed by Shivam Nair, the film will be released on 7 March. The story, screenplay and dialogue of 'The Diplomat' are written by Ritesh Shah. The film is shared by Dimo Popov. The film's composer is AR Rahman. The songs are written by Manoj Muntashir. Revathi, Kumud Mishra and Sharib Hashmi have played important roles in this.
Talking about the work of actor John Abraham, he was seen in 'Veda' before. The film also played the lead role by Sharawari Wagh, but the film flopped badly at the box office.
